How to Take Levitra: A Comprehensive Guide

Levitra, a medication used to treat erectile dysfunction, can provide significant benefits for those experiencing difficulties in achieving or maintaining an erection. Understanding how to take Levitra properly is essential to ensure its effectiveness and minimize potential side effects.

1. Dosage Recommendations

Before taking Levitra, it’s important to follow the prescribed dosage provided by your healthcare provider. The typical guidelines include:

  1. Starting Dose: The usual starting dose for most men is 10 mg taken approximately 60 minutes before sexual activity.
  2. Maximum Dose: Depending on individual response, the dose may be adjusted to a maximum of 20 mg or reduced to 5 mg.
  3. Frequency: Levitra should be taken no more than once a day.

2. Taking Levitra Effectively

For optimal results, follow these steps when taking Levitra:

  1. Timing: Take Levitra about 60 minutes before you plan to engage in sexual activity, allowing the medication adequate time to work.
  2. With or Without Food: You can take Levitra with or without food; however, consuming a high-fat meal may delay the onset of its effects.
  3. Form: Levitra is typically available in tablet form, which should be swallowed whole with water; do not chew or crush the tablet.

3. Important Considerations

Keep the following tips in mind to ensure safe and effective use of Levitra:

  1. Consult Your Doctor: Always consult your healthcare professional before starting Levitra, especially if you have underlying health conditions or are taking other medications.
  2. Avoid Alcohol: Limit alcohol consumption before taking Levitra, as it may hinder the effectiveness of the medication.
  3. Be Aware of Side Effects: Know the potential side effects, such as headaches, flushing, or dizziness, and report any severe reactions to your doctor.

4. When to Seek Help

If you experience any of the following, seek immediate medical attention:

  • Severe allergic reactions, including rash, itching, or difficulty breathing.
  • Prolonged or painful erection lasting more than four hours (priapism).
  • Sudden vision loss in one or both eyes.
